Ecosia is a privacy-focused search engine headquartered in Berlin, Germany, founded by Christian Kroll in 2009. What sets Ecosia apart from other search engines is its unique environmental mission: the company uses 80% of its profits to fund tree-planting projects around the world, having planted over 199 million trees to date. As a certified B Corporation since 2014 and owned by the Purpose Foundation since 2018, Ecosia operates as a not-for-profit organization where no individual, including the founder, can profit from dividends or a sale of the company.
Ecosia partners with Microsoft Bing and Google to deliver search results and advertisements. When you search, your IP address and search terms are shared with these partners to provide results and prevent fraud. Ecosia anonymizes your IP address within 7 days, while Microsoft and Google retain obfuscated data for up to 90 days. The company does not create personal profiles based on your search history and does not store your searches permanently. Advertisements are not personalized by default, though you can opt into personalization if you choose.
The privacy policy is notably transparent about third-party integrations. Beyond search partners, Ecosia works with Cloudflare for security, Didomi for consent management, Braze for communications, and various analytics tools. For mobile apps, Singular tracks install attribution. Social media platforms receive anonymous metadata about app installations for marketing optimization, but never your search data. All these integrations are disclosed and most require explicit consent under GDPR.
Ecosia is fully compliant with GDPR and all German and European data protection regulations. The company’s servers are distributed globally for performance, but EU users’ traffic typically stays within Europe. Users have complete rights to access, correct, delete, and export their personal data. The Data Protection Officer can be contacted at privacy@ecosia.org.
In 2024-2025, Ecosia partnered with French search engine Qwant to launch Staan, a European search index designed to reduce dependence on American tech giants. This represents a significant step toward European digital sovereignty in search.

Privacy Highlights
Ecosia implements meaningful privacy protections while being transparent about its limitations. The company retains IP addresses for a maximum of 7 days before anonymization or deletion. Search terms and IP addresses are shared with Microsoft Bing or Google to deliver results, with IPs transmitted in obfuscated form and deleted by partners within 90 days.
The privacy policy thoroughly documents all third-party integrations: Cloudflare for spam protection (anonymized IPs, most deleted within days), Didomi for consent management in the EEA, Braze for website communications, and OpenAI for the chat feature. Social media platforms receive only anonymous install attribution data, never search behavior.
By default, advertisements are not personalized. Users can opt into personalization through cookie consent, which enables Microsoft Clarity behavioral analytics or Google’s personalization cookies depending on your chosen search provider. In the EU, UK, and certain US states, no additional cookies are set without explicit consent.
All data processing adheres to GDPR requirements, with Ecosia GmbH (Berlin) serving as the responsible data controller. US data transfers are protected by EU Standard Contractual Clauses and the EU-US Data Privacy Framework certifications held by partners including Microsoft, Google, and Cloudflare.
